LEARNING ACTIVITY

A.
1. A number increased by five
Ans. x + 5
2. Twice the square of a number
Ans. 2 x 2
3. The square of the sum of two numbers
Ans. (x + y)2
4. The sum of the squares of two numbers
Ans. x2 + y2
5. A number less by three
Ans. x - 3
6. Twice of a number added by four
Ans. 2x + 4
7. The cube of a number less than five
Ans. 5 − x3
8. The area of a rectangle whose length is seven more than its width
A = w(w + 7)
Ans. A = w2 + 7w
9. The difference of a square of two numbers
Ans. x2 −y2
10. The quotient of the sum of two numbers by another number
x+y
Ans. z

2. List down all the subsets of a set (5 points)


A = { a, b, c, d }.
Ans. {}; {a}; {b};{c}; {d}; {a,b}; {a,c}; {a,d}; {b,c}; {b,d}; {c,d}; {a,b,c}; {a,b,d};
{a,c,d}; {b,c,d}; {a,b,c,d};
3. If A = {1,2,3} and B={i,o,u}, find A x B. (5 points)
Ans. A x B={(1, i), (1, o), (1, u), (2, i), (2, o), (2, u), (3, i), (3, o), (3, u)}
